Travel details: Sunspel Riviera Polo

Sunspel’s creative director David Telfer explains why the Riviera Polo shirt continues to be a wardrobe staple

Travel to the southeastern corner of France, and you’ll find yourself in the dreamy expanse of the Côte d’Azur. Famous for its blue skies, warm climate and for hosting the Cannes Film Festival, this sun-drenched enclave is also the birthplace of Sunspel’s Riviera Polo shirt. 

This refined take on a wardrobe classic features a two-button placket, a neatly structured collar, a front chest pocket and a tailored silhouette that makes for a complementary fit. But what sets the Sunspel Riviera apart is its innovative fabric. 

‘It was created by the great-grandson of our founder, who sought to develop the ideal fabric for his holidays,’ explains Sunspel’s creative director, David Telfer. Originally designed in 1955, Peter Hill found the dense piqué polos of the time too heavy for the Blue Coast, where temperatures often soar above 30 degrees. Thus, Q75 was born – an innovative, lightweight fabric that remains the defining feature of the shirt today. ‘Dissatisfied with the heavy, harsh piqués available at the time, he designed a breathable, lightweight warp knit mesh that offered both comfort and elegance,’ Telfer continues. 

From the quiet romance of the Côte d’Azur to the high-stakes glamour of Hollywood, the Riviera Polo cemented its cult status half a century after its inception when it appeared in 2006’s Casino Royale. And it’s hard to imagine a more fitting garment for Daniel Craig’s 007 debut, something Telfer credits as pivotal to the shirt’s lasting appeal: ‘Its iconic status was solidified when Lindy Hemming was tasked with reimagining James Bond’s style, choosing Sunspel as the British brand to define the new era.’

Working closely with the Oscar-winning costume designer, Sunspel refined the fit, slimming the chest and shortening the sleeves to perfectly suit Craig’s frame, ‘She tailored the Riviera Polo specifically for Casino Royale, marking a shift to a more contemporary and authentic Bond.’ The shirt’s traditional British heritage mixed with its contemporary charm, solidifies it as the perfect off-duty uniform for the world’s most legendary spy. 

Founded as an underwear brand, Sunspel has always understood that true luxury starts with what lies beneath the surface. That’s why it promises to pay careful attention to every part of the supply chain, from the California farm that grows the brand’s favoured Supima cotton to the factories that craft its final product. It ensures each and every stage adheres to the brand’s four key principles – a set of values intrinsically tied to ethics and sustainability. 

And the Riviera Polo is no exception. Crafted from Californian Supima, one of the world’s finest and rarest cottons, the fabric’s extra-long staple fibres make it not only exceptionally soft but also 40 per cent longer than standard cotton, increasing durability and resistance.

‘The design has remained unchanged, with only one improvement: an upgrade to extra-long staple Supima cotton, enhancing durability, softness and traceability, ensuring the Riviera Polo remains a true classic,’ says Telfer. 

Beyond fabric innovation, sustainability is woven into Sunspel’s DNA. The majority of its cotton can be traced back to a single family-owned farm in California’s San Joaquin Valley. Established in 1920, the farm upholds the highest environmental standards, practicing crop rotation to replenish soil nutrients and using drip irrigation to minimise water consumption.

Longevity is not just a promise but a practice at Sunspel. The brand maintains longstanding relationships with its suppliers and fosters a team of second- and third-generation employees, some of whom have been with the company for more than two decades.
